🎉 Meet Dana Pitts - From Nova Scotia to Sarnia, Ontario, Dana's journey is a tale of dedication and passion! 🧑🚒
A proud alum of St. Patrick’s High and the Ontario Fire College, Dana climbed the ladder of the Ontario Fire Service for 35 years, earning his Chief Fire Officer designation before retiring as Deputy Chief at Sarnia Fire Rescue. 🚒👨🚒
Now, he's switched his helmet for a pen. 📚 Dana’s lifelong love for storytelling, inspired by his mom Helen (a former Grammar School teacher), has led him to become a first-time author. Besides writing, he's got a knack for photography, travel, and gourmet cooking—he even co-owned the Small Batch Cafe in Kingston, Ontario! 🍳📸✈️
With two kids, five grandkids, and a heart full of stories, Dana now calls Milford, Nova Scotia home. 🏡✨
